So I am getting ready to install all my stereo.....my brother spoiled me for Christmas...... and I have my Sub-X enclosure.......... but I have spent forever trying to find amp locations

where is everyone putting their amps? Mine is too big to go in the storage under the seats...... there is no air flow down their anyways.......

and if I put it under my drivers seat....is anyone bolting the amp down....please help

I have always screwed the amp down to the floor. Not gonna move around too much. Run the wires through the split where the seat harness comes through.

Mine is located under the driver seat. I didn't bolt it down tho but it shouldn't move around because my Husky mats sorta keep it in place.

Under driver seat because the battery is located on the driver side and that is where I ran my wires also.

Disconnect the battery if you plan on removing the driver's seat. Not sure if you have a side airbag or not but you probably don't want to set that off. KABOOM!

If you really didnt want to screw the amp down you could always try some good velcro. A couple of two inch wide strips down the amp should prevent it from moving unless it was seriously kicked

Using a small self-tapping screw to hold them to the carpet is the best way. You never see the holes, even when the amp is removed.

I have mine under the seats. Just for the heads up there will be some slight modifications needed on the passenger and for me the driver seat. I had to use a little cut off wheel and it took probably 20 mins. Good luck with the install. Depending on your amp's depth on the passenger side you will either have to cut this bar off or turn it upside down.

If you have to do that, you might wanna try to flip the bar upside-down. I cut the bar off and the seat was just a tad bit wobbly without it in there

Under the drivers seat, get some velcro and use the hard part only and stick it on the under side of the amp. It'll grab hold of the carpet just like the other piece of velcro would. Won't go anywhere.

I have one under each seat, metal brackets to the seat bolts so they can't be 'ripped out'.
